In Canada we had a lot of bands coming from Halifax for a while (pop.
~600,000 including outlying communities). That was around the same time as
the big grunge thing from Seattle leading the brilliant press to call
Halifax "Seattle North" despite its being geographically South of Seattle
(and WAY WAY East of it).

Now with the internet and all that musicians are leaking out from all over
the country and making names for themselves independantly from the big
recording companies. I suspect the same sort of thing is going on in the US
and UK. The whole biz is becoming very much decentralized because of the
technology available. It's not necessarily a good or bad thing but it is a
different thing from the olde days when everyone had to go to Toronto to
make it in Canada, New York or LA to make it in the US or London to make it
in the UK. Where'd you have to go to make it in Albania I wonder?

With all the decentralization it's unlikely we'll ever see such mania as was
seen in '63 again.
